Of course, there's another problem all of you people so adamant on everyone sharing to 1.0 or better seem to miss...it is impossible for everyone to seed to 1.0. For every amount of data beyond the original size of the torrent the seeder shares, it makes it even more difficult for everyone else to get a good ratio, because that's data they could have shared. And the more people you have with share ratios that are significantly above 1.0, the more more uberleechers it will produce. Because the ubersharers shared so much data, there may not be an opportunity for lesser-equipped sharers to share what they have back.
